Kinds Of Driving Licenses for Foreigners

Foreign nationals can either utilize their existing driving license or obtain a Belgian driving license depending upon their circumstances.

Using an Existing Foreign Driving License

  1. Credibility Period: Most foreign driving licenses stand for one year from the date of residency in Belgium.
  2. Chauffeur's Country: The exchangeability of driving licenses differs based upon the issuing country. EU/EEA driving licenses can usually be exchanged without trouble, while licenses from non-EU nations may require extra screening.

Obtaining a Belgian Driving License

For foreigners whose driving licenses are no longer valid or for those who choose to obtain a local license, the process may involve the following steps.

Steps to Obtain a Belgian Driving License

  1. Register for Lessons: Enroll in a driving school acknowledged by the Belgian government.
  2. Pass a Theory Test: Study the Belgian road code and pass a composed exam.
  3. Complete Practical Training: Undergo useful lessons with an instructor.
  4. Take the Practical Test: Successfully complete a useful driving test.
  5. Health Certificate: Obtain a medical certificate validating your fitness to drive.
  6. Pay Fees: Provide payment for administrative charges related to the assessment process.

Requirements for Foreigners Seeking a Belgian Driving License

Foreign nationals should fulfill particular requirements to be qualified for a Belgian driving license. These include:

  1. Age: Must satisfy the minimum age requirement based upon license classification.
  2. Residency: Must be a registered local in Belgium.
  3. Identification: Valid ID, such as a passport or nationwide ID card.
  4. Medical Certificate: Required for all applicants, suggesting no medical conditions that might hinder driving abilities.
  5. Proof of Former License (if appropriate): If exchanging a foreign license, proof of its validity is required.

FAQs

1. Can I drive in Belgium with a foreign driving license?

Yes, you can drive with a valid foreign driving license for up to one year from your date of residency in Belgium. After that, you must either exchange it or obtain a Belgian license.

2. What if I hold a driving license from a non-EU country?

You might require to take a driving test to obtain a Belgian license, as licenses from non-EU nations are not immediately exchangeable.

3. How long does it require to obtain a Belgian driving license?

The timeline varies based on individual scenarios, however it generally takes a couple of months, depending upon the accessibility of driving lessons and tests.

4. Are there extra requirements for getting a license if I'm over 60?

Older applicants might go through additional health requirements, consisting of more extensive medical checkups.
